Steel provides exceptional load-bearing capacity with lower structural self-weight, reducing foundation costs by up to 30% and optimizing architectural layouts with large open spaces.
Prefabrication under controlled factory settings guarantees dimensional tolerances. Precise bolt-connected site assemblies avoid delays caused by weather conditions and structural adjustments.
Structural steel is 100% recyclable, which supports circular economy models and aligns with LEED and BREEAM certifications for sustainable real estate assets.
Advanced hot-dip galvanization and high-performance polyurea coatings protect steel systems from aggressive environments, rust, rot, and pest infestations.

By leveraging Building Information Modeling (BIM) via software platforms like Tekla Structures, designers maintain absolute alignment between architectural layout, fabrication models, and onsite assembly steps. This prevents structural collisions and ensures high accuracy.
State-of-the-art CNC cutting, drilling, and automated robotic welding ensure stable weld penetrations. This results in consistent compliance with AWS D1.1 (American Welding Society) and EN 1090 European structural standards.
Decarbonizing industrial spaces relies heavily on using steel with high post-consumer recycled content, utilizing energy-efficient sandwich panels, and implementing solar-ready roof load capacities.
| Feature Parameter | Standard Steel Option (Q235) | High-Yield Structural Steel (Q355B / ASTM A572) | Engineering Benefit |
|---|---|---|---|
| Yield Strength (min) | 235 MPa | 355 MPa | 33% increase in load limits; enables longer column-free spans. |
| Tensile Strength | 370 - 500 MPa | 470 - 630 MPa | Enhanced resistance to ultimate structural failure. |
| Welding Suitability | Excellent | Excellent (Requires strict thermal control) | Reliable joints in heavy moments-resisting portal frames. |
| Environmental Adaptability | Standard | Superb when paired with HDG treatment | Extended service life (>50 years) in maritime or industrial zones. |
